Good Design, Consistent, Even Grind Had it for about two months now. Use it once a day for my morning coffee. I’ve mostly used the fine grind, and the results are consistent and comparable to my Baratza plug in grinder. This has a nice design, feels solidly built, and comes with a convenient traveling/storage pouch. I brew about 20-24 grams of beans and most times it grinds them all in one go. Sometimes some of beans didn’t drop all the way down so I need to shake it slightly and run it again for a few seconds to finish the grind. If I was grinding more, I suspect I might have to run it twice to get all the beans. Using it once daily, I’ve gone about two weeks (M-F) between charges. If I used it multiple times a day I’d probably need to charge it more often. It’s also so much quieter than my burr grinder plug in machine too. The ground coffee likes to stick to the top when you unscrew the cup so the brush it comes with is helpful. Though I just tap it gently a couple times and a lot comes loose. The only thing I wish was if the cup at the bottom had some kind of subtle spout design for better control when pouring the ground coffee into my aeropress device. Sometimes it spreads out a little when pouring and some of it misses the Aeropress funnel, which makes a mess. Overall, I’m pleased with the purchase so far, and I hope it lasts a long time. If it does, then it was well worth the price tag. Would recommend it. Though wait for it to go on sale maybe if you’re having sticker shock, cause it does sometimes drop.
